Ingredients
Scale
- 4 cups (500g) bread flour or all-purpose flour
- 2 ¼ teaspoons (7g) active dry yeast or instant yeast
- 2 teaspoons (10g) salt
- 1 ¾ cups (415ml) warm water
- ¼ cup (60ml) extra virgin olive oil (plus extra for drizzling)
- 2 tablespoons fresh rosemary leaves
- Coarse sea salt for sprinkling
Instructions
-
Mixing and Kneading the Dough:
- In a large bowl, combine 4 cups of flour, 2 teaspoons of salt, and 2 ¼ teaspoons of yeast.
- Add 1 ¾ cups of warm water and ¼ cup of olive oil.
- Mix until a shaggy dough forms, then knead for about 10 minutes until smooth and elastic.
-
First Rise:
- Place the dough in an oiled bowl, cover with plastic wrap, and let it rise in a warm spot for 1-2 hours or until doubled in size.
-
Shaping and Dimpling the Focaccia:
- Grease a baking sheet with olive oil.
- Gently stretch the dough to fit the pan.
- Use your fingertips to create those signature dimples all over the surface.
-
Second Rise:
- Cover the dough and let it rise again for about 30 minutes.
-
Topping and Baking:
-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).
- Drizzle the focaccia generously with olive oil, sprinkle with sea salt, and top with rosemary.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es until golden brown.
Notes
- Focaccia bread can be served warm or at room temperature. It pairs wonderfully with soups, stews, or as a side to your favorite Italian dishes.
- For added flavor, you can top the focaccia with other ingredients such as olives, sun-dried tomatoes, or garlic before baking.
